G'day everyone.

So I am about to enter the Ledge To Lancelin and apparently I need to provide:

Evidence of federation membership (Windsurfing & Kitesurfing) and Evidence of valid third party insurance to the value of $1Mn.

Any suggestions?

So... after an hours googling:

Join a club like the Storm Riders (or others) in NSW for about $60 or $200 and this covers your membership affilitation and insurance.
I am still confused about the entitlement to sail as a guest at other clubs part which is only covered for the expensive membership.

For LOC this year you need to be a member of any AWA affiliated club or any state association. Our preference is to get people engaged with WWA as we have a great calendar of racing and wave sailing coming up but if LOC is your only event, you can buy a one day membership via the WWA web site

WWA Membership Page - https://windsurfingwa.tidyclub.com/public/memberships/new

If you are travelling from interstate, join your local club or state and you will be covered.
